Dec 26, 2006
 
Ron W wrote:
I have the same problem Bill, it just started a week ago. What did the dealer say the second time around?
The dealer installed a canister that is filled with charcoal that sits on top of the gas tank. I have my paper work in the car so I don't have the technical terms off the top of my head. It has been working fine since they installed it. They said the canister was full of fuel from topping off my tank. I always filled it to the brim because of the miles I put on the car. Now I just round up to the next dollar when filling. It seems to be working. Let me know if you need more info. I would be glad to help.

I've tried using compressed air to blow out the vent lines that are attached to the top of the gas tank. These lines are supposed to vent the tank (let the air out) while filling it so the gas will flow in. Did not seem to help. Now I am starting to think the gas pump nozzles have been made more sensitive (shut off easier) by EPA to reduce spills/overflows at gas stations. I may try to run a wire down the fill line and see if I can find a "blockage" of some sort.

i got the same thing on my cutlass supreme i fill 2 to 3 dollars worth when gas comes out the top of the filler neck. i am wondering if there is a valve on the vapor line going to the purge canister ,and that it s not operating properly increasing the pressure in the fuel tank enough to keep the one way valve at the bottom of the fuel filler hose ? has anyone heard a sound coming from the gas tank like it s lost pressure suddenly like a 2 litre getting crushed a bit by sucking the air out of it?
